How to Find a Private Psychiatrist in the UK
Finding the ideal mental health care specialist can be a daunting job, particularly when considering private psychiatry. The UK uses a diverse variety of mental health services, however lots of individuals seeking treatment often prefer the individualized technique that private psychiatrists provide. This short article will guide you through the actions needed to find a private psychiatrist in the UK, what factors to think about, and responses to often asked concerns.
Understanding Private Psychiatry
Private psychiatry describes mental healthcare services offered by specialists who run outside the National Health Service (NHS). Patients who select private psychiatry often seek quicker access to consultations, a broader choice of professionals, and various treatment options that might not be readily available through civil services.
Advantages of Private PsychiatryLowered Waiting Times: Patients typically experience considerably shorter wait times for consultations.Flexible Scheduling: Appointment times can be more accommodating to the patient's requirements.Personalized Care: Patients may have more opportunities for one-on-one time with their psychiatrist.Access to Specialists: Availability of a larger variety of specialties and treatment techniques.Steps to Find a Private Psychiatrist
The procedure of discovering a private psychiatrist involves several crucial actions. The following guide describes these steps in detail:
1. Determine Your Needs
Before you start trying to find a psychiatrist, it's essential to understand what you require. Think about the following:
Type of Therapy Needed: Are you searching for medication management, psychotherapy, or both?Expertise: Some psychiatrists concentrate on particular areas, such as stress and anxiety disorders, depression, ADHD, or injury.Preferred Treatment Methods: Some experts might integrate alternative treatments or prefer evidence-based medication, so it's necessary to know what you're searching for.2. Research Potential Psychiatrists
Conduct comprehensive research study to put together a list of potential psychiatrists. Here are some resources to consider:
Online Directories: Websites like the Royal College of Psychiatrists, Therapy Directory, or Psychology Today can provide listings of qualified psychiatrists in your location.Word of Mouth: Recommendations from family, buddies, or other healthcare specialists can lead you to respectable psychiatrists.Insurance Providers: If you have private health insurance coverage, check which psychiatrists are covered under your strategy.3. Check Qualifications and Experience
As soon as you have a list, it's important to confirm each prospect's credentials. Try to find:
Medical Qualifications: Ensure that the psychiatrist is registered with the General Medical Council (GMC) and is a member of an expert body, such as the Royal College of Psychiatrists.Experience: Review their experience in treating your specific condition.Client Reviews: Online reviews or reviews can supply extra insights into the psychiatrist's approach and efficiency.4. How do I know if I require to see a psychiatrist?
If you are experiencing consistent symptoms affecting your every day life, such as extreme state of mind swings, stress and anxiety, depression, or modifications in habits, it may be time to consider seeking advice from a psychiatrist.
2. Can I self-refer to a private psychiatrist?
Yes, people can self-refer to private psychiatrists without needing a recommendation from a GP, which is frequently required for NHS services.
3. Will my insurance cover the costs of a private psychiatrist?
Many private medical insurance plans offer coverage for professional psychiatric services, but it's important to examine your particular policy information.
4. What can I expect throughout my very first consultation?
During the first assessment, you can expect to discuss your symptoms, individual history, treatment goals, and any issues you might have relating to the treatment procedure.
5. For how long will I require to see a psychiatrist?
The duration of treatment varies widely depending on the person's needs and the intricacy of their condition. Routine ongoing evaluations will help determine the continued requirement of sessions.
